Super7 ReAction Transformers get Updated Stock Photos and Future Lineup

Posted by Emerje Nov 7, 2019 at 11:28pm CST 28,297 views
Thanks to our various advertising sponsors (TFSource, BBTS, Entertainment Earth, Ages 3+ Up) we have new stock photos of Super7's ReAction Transformers! For those not aware, ReAction is Super7's line of retro-style action figures, usually with five points of articulation at 3.75" scale. Think of them like Action Masters, but with less articulation. This is our first time seeing these figures in color, the last time we saw them at Toy Fair 2019 they were still in the gray prototype stage. Each figure comes with a weapon accessory (including Starscream who comes with a gun Megatron) except for Megatron who's canon is certainly large enough. And that's not all, the packaging has been greatly updated. Now the card backs feature higher quality art on full color backdrops instead of the G1-style grid pattern.

The first wave should be released soon (originally planned for October, now November) consisting of Optimus Prime, Jazz, Bumblebee, Megatron, Starscream, and Soundwave. Next will be an even more ambitious set for February made up of Alpha Trion, Skyfire, Mirage, Grimlock, Shockwave, Rumble, Shrapnel, and Devastator. The suggested price is $15 though most retailers seem to be more comfortable $18.

JelZe GoldRabbit wrote:The ReAction logo is styled after Kenner's... Huh, neat.
I might be wrong, but I think they started off using old Kenner molds of Alien figures, that may or may not have been released. But then went crazy and "ReActioned" every thing.


EDIT: been wondering this myself for some time so I looked it up. Seems the original ReAction figures were based on Kenner prototype figures for the Alien movie. The molds were never made and the figures never released.

Super7 used a mix of castings of some of the prototypes and pictures to recreate the the first series of ReAction figures.
